I'd recommend Low Limit Hold'em by Lee Jones first, then Ed Miller's book. LLH is a bit simpler and, I think, more applicable to your home game.

And don't forget one of the key rules: Loose at at tight table and tight at a loose table.

I rarely get aggressive in the kind of game you're describing unless I *know* I have them whipped. No point if they'll never fold. Think about what outcome you want from a bet/raise. If you're not going to get that outcome (i.e. a fold or virtually guaranteed money), why do it?
